What's Included in Our Commercial Radon Services in Bratenahl OH

Commercial radon work is not a scaled-up version of a house. Buildings have multiple foundation types, HVAC interactions, occupied tenant spaces, and reporting obligations a residence doesn't. Our commercial scope is built around that reality.

1. EPA-Aligned Commercial Radon Testing (Initial and Long-Term)

We deploy continuous radon monitors and passive devices across statistically valid sampling locations — lowest occupied levels, ground-contact rooms, and zones where building pressure dynamics concentrate radon. For schools and apartments, we follow ANSI-AARST MAMF and MALB protocols. Results are documented in a written report suitable for lenders, buyers, school boards, and the Ohio Department of Health.

Standard turnaround: 48-hour test, written results within 72 hours.

2. Custom Sub-Slab Depressurization System Design

Every commercial mitigation system we install in Bratenahl is engineered to the building — not pulled off a shelf. We perform diagnostic communication testing to map sub-slab airflow, then design suction-point placement, pipe routing, and fan sizing around it. For multi-zone buildings, that often means multiple independent systems rather than one undersized riser.

3. Code-Compliant Installation by Ohio-Licensed Mitigators

Every install is performed under RC202. Discharge points meet the 10-foot horizontal / 10-foot vertical separation rules. Electrical work meets NEC. Fans are mounted in unconditioned space. Manometers are visible and labeled. Penetrations are sealed. The system passes a post-mitigation verification test — or we keep working until it does.

4. Post-Mitigation Verification and Documentation Package

After installation, we re-test the building and deliver a complete documentation packet: as-built drawings, fan specs, post-mitigation pCi/L readings, license documentation, and warranty paperwork. This is the package your buyer, attorney, or insurer expects — and the one most local installers don't produce.

5. Ongoing Monitoring and Re-Test Programs

EPA recommends commercial buildings be re-tested every two years and after any major HVAC or structural change. We offer scheduled re-testing contracts for Bratenahl apartment owners, property managers, and school districts so compliance never falls off the calendar.

Our Commercial Radon Process — From First Call to Final Report

We've refined this workflow on hundreds of commercial properties across Northeast Ohio. It's built to give Bratenahl owners, investors, and brokers a clean, defensible paper trail at every step.

  1. Site Assessment (Day 1–2): An RC202-licensed mitigator walks the building, reviews foundation type, HVAC zones, and any prior test results. We deliver a written scope and fixed-price quote.
  2. Initial Testing (Day 3–5): Continuous radon monitors are deployed at code-required density. Tenants and staff are notified per protocol. Results documented.
  3. System Design (Day 5–7): Engineering drawings produced. Suction points, riser routing, fan model, and discharge location finalized. Permits pulled where required.
  4. Installation (Day 7–14): Crews install with minimal tenant disruption. Most commercial installations complete in 1–4 days depending on building size.
  5. Post-Mitigation Testing & Report (Day 14–17): Verification testing confirms levels below 4.0 pCi/L — typically under 2.0. Final documentation delivered.

Commercial Radon Services Pricing in Bratenahl

We publish ranges because we believe you deserve to know what a project costs before you pick up the phone. Final pricing is written and fixed before any work starts.

  • Commercial radon testing (small buildings, under 10,000 sq ft): typically $450–$1,200 depending on device count.
  • Multi-family / apartment testing (per ANSI-AARST MAMF): $25–$75 per ground-contact unit.
  • Standard commercial mitigation system (single foundation zone): typically $2,500–$5,500 installed.
  • Multi-zone or large-building mitigation: custom-engineered, typically $6,000–$25,000+.
  • School and institutional projects: scoped individually under ANSI-AARST CCAH protocols.

How do I choose a commercial radon services provider in Bratenahl?

Verify three things: (1) Ohio license number — ask for it and look it up, (2) experience with your building type (apartment, office, school, etc.), and (3) whether they follow ANSI-AARST commercial protocols (MAMF, MALB, CCAH). If any of those answers are vague, keep looking.

What should I look for in commercial radon services?

Look for licensed mitigators, written diagnostic and design documentation, code-compliant discharge and electrical work, post-mitigation verification testing, and a full report package suitable for lenders, buyers, or regulators. Avoid contractors who can't produce a sample report.

How long does commercial radon mitigation take?

From first call to final report, most Bratenahl commercial projects close out in 2–3 weeks. For real-estate transactions, we routinely compress to 7–10 days. Actual installation is usually 1–4 days depending on building size and zone count.
